The iPhone 14 and 13 Wallpaper size (1170×2532px)
1170x2532 pixels is the native resolution of the iPhone 14, iPhone 13, and iPhone 12 family, one of the most widely owned iPhone screen sizes. All use a tall 9:19.5 Super Retina display, so a wallpaper at this exact size fills the panel edge to edge with no upscaling and stays sharp on the lock and home screens.
Since this 19.5:9 shape is much taller than older iPhones, a wallpaper made for a 4:3 or shorter screen tends to crop or zoom when applied. Resizing to a native 1170x2532 provides iOS the precise vertical canvas it needs, keeping proportions correct and preventing the important part of your image from being cut off during the automatic fit.
Design with the interface in mind. The lock screen places a large clock in the upper-middle with the date above it, and the home screen covers its lower two-thirds with app icons and the dock. For a lock-screen wallpaper, keep faces and focal points in the central strip below the clock; for a home-screen wallpaper, choose something that still looks good behind rows of icons.
